Title: Senior Java Engineer
Location: Columbus, OH (Preferred) / Remote
Industry: Banking / Financial Services Job Summary:
We are seeking a highly skilled Senior Java Engineer with strong backend development experience in the banking/financial domain. The ideal candidate will have expertise in building scalable, high-performance applications using modern Java technologies and frameworks. Key Responsibilities:
Design, develop, and maintain Java-based backend applications and services
Build scalable APIs and microservices using Spring / Spring Boot
Troubleshoot production issues and perform root cause analysis
Collaborate with cross-functional teams to translate business requirements into technical solutions
Contribute to CI/CD pipelines, automated builds, and deployments
Enhance system performance, reliability, and security
Improve system observability (logging, monitoring, alerts) Required Qualifications:
6+ years of experience in Java development
Strong expertise in Core Java, JVM, data structures, algorithms, and concurrency
Hands-on experience with Spring / Spring Boot
Experience in building and consuming REST APIs (JSON)
Proficiency with Git and version control workflows
Experience with unit testing frameworks (JUnit, TestNG, Mockito)
Strong troubleshooting and debugging skills in distributed systems
Experience working in Agile environments
Good understanding of DevOps practices Preferred Qualifications:
Experience in banking or financial services domain
Exposure to Azure cloud services
Experience in deploying and managing cloud-based applications Interview Process:
2 Rounds (Video Interview)
1 Round includes Coding Assessment
Thanks & Regards,
Adarsh Mallik IT Recruiter
CENTSTONE SERVICES
Address: 3400 State Route 35, Suite 9B, Hazlet, New Jersey, 07730 USA.